Jenna is the cover story for the 15th anniversary edition of Vegas magazine and in the interview, she talks about meeting Channing Tatum on the set of Step Up. “We started out as friends, and I would say it was an instant recognition,” she said. “When we met it felt like we had known each other for many years.”

She shared that even though their romantic relationship is over, their friendship remains: “Ultimately, no matter what Chan and I are doing, we’re really great friends. I think that will never change, no matter what.”

Jenna also talked about returning to her dance roots as the host of World of Dance. “It fulfills my soul on a level that most work and jobs do not because dance is my true passion,” she said.

She continued: “It’s always been something at the root of who I am; it’s in my blood. I did not see this job coming, and I didn’t know what to expect because I never really had the intention of hosting, ever. [But] I’m in a place in my life where I’m ready to say yes.”

“Being a dancer, you’re ingrained with this mentality to make it work, and you can do it all, but as I matured … and had a child, I’ve realized that you do the things you’re meant to do,” she said. “You have to protect that and trust that even though you’re saying no to things, there are a ton of other, better yeses that will be coming.”

Jenna and Channing announced their separation on April 2.

“We have lovingly chosen to separate as a couple. We fell deeply in love so many years ago and have had a magical journey together. Absolutely nothing has changed about how much we love one another, but love is a beautiful adventure that is taking us on different paths for now,” the statement read. “There are no secrets nor salacious events at the root of our decision — just two best-friends realizing it’s time to take some space and help each other live the most joyous, fulfilled lives as possible. We are still a family and will always be loving dedicated parents to Everly. We won’t be commenting beyond this, and we thank you all in advance for respecting our family’s privacy.”
